Farrow & Ball Dead Flat Paint in the 'Drop Cloth' shade is an ideal choice for homeowners and interior designers seeking a sophisticated, ultra-matte finish for walls, woodwork, and metal surfaces in high-traffic areas. This premium, English-crafted paint offers a unique alkyd resin formula that balances a delicate, vintage aesthetic with remarkable scuff resistance and durability, though users should be aware that achieving the best results requires careful surface preparation compared to standard wall paints.

FAQs

Can I use this on radiators?

Yes, the Dead Flat formula is suitable for metal, provided the surface is properly prepared and primed if necessary.

What is the finish level of this paint?

This paint features an ultra-matte, flat finish with very low light reflection.

How many coats are typically needed?

Two full coats are usually recommended for a uniform, deep color payoff.

Is 'Drop Cloth' a warm or cool color?

It is a balanced mid-grey beige that is neither overly yellow nor overly grey, making it a neutral staple.

Does it require a primer?

While the paint has excellent coverage, we recommend a primer on new or porous surfaces for the best results.

Troubleshooting

Uneven finish or brush marks

Ensure you are using a high-quality synthetic brush and avoid overworking the paint as it begins to dry.

Paint not sticking to surface

Check that the surface was properly cleaned and degreased. If applying over glossy surfaces, use a primer first.

Setup, Compatibility & Care

Before beginning your project, ensure all surfaces are clean, dry, and free from dust or grease. For wood or metal, lightly sand the surface to improve adhesion. Using a high-quality brush or roller designed for water-based paints is recommended to achieve the signature dead-flat finish. When cleaning, use a soft, damp cloth with mild soap if necessary; avoid abrasive scrubbers that may damage the matte texture. Store any remaining paint in a cool, dry place with the lid sealed tightly to prevent skinning and ensure long-term usability.
